Department of Commerce Announces Direct Funding Agreement with Bosch for a $225 Million CHIPS Program Award to Support Domestic Production of Silicon Carbide Semiconductors

The Department of Commerce’s CHIPS Program Office announced today the signing of a Direct Funding Agreement with Robert Bosch Semiconductor LLC (“Bosch”) for up to $225 million in incentives under the CHIPS and Science Act.
